WWE’s biggest event, WrestleMania 40, was held as a two-night event at the Lincoln Financial Field in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, on April 6 and 7, 2024. Professional wrestlers from the RAW and SmackDown brand divisions were witnessed fighting in the ring for the respected titles. Roman Reigns vs. Cody Rhodes was the main attraction of the event this year with the addition of WWE Hall of Famer The Undertaker.

Cody Rhodes defeats Roman Reigns to ‘finish the story’

On the first night of WrestleMania 40, Cody Rhodes and Seth Rollins teamed up to fight against Roman Reigns and The Rock in a tag team match, which the former team lost. As a result, the main event, i.e., Cody Rhodes vs. Roman Reigns, for the title of WWE Universal Champion, was held according to Bloodline Rules.

Fans already had a lot of expectations with the Bloodline Rules match, along with speculations about Stone Cold Steven Austin and John Cena coming in to help Rhodes win. After the two wrestlers entered the ring, the crowd started chanting their names, and an interesting match between the two took place. At one point, John Cena entered the ring to help Cody Rhodes and hit Solo Sikoa with an AA in addition to hitting Reigns with an AA.

Forbes reported that The Rock saw this as an opportunity to help his Tribal Chief and entered the ring, which led to the showdown between The Rock and Cena, rekindling the match moments of WrestleMania 29 and 30. It didn’t take much time for The Rock to put Cena down. But it was WWE Hall of Famer The Undertaker’s surprise entry that not only shook the audience but The Rock too.

The Undertaker took down The Rock with a choke slam. Finally, Cody Rhodes managed to defeat Roman Reigns and end his streak and finish his story.

The most noteworthy match between The Undertaker and the Great One is from 1999 when Rock issued a challenge against The Undertaker after he had cost him a match against Triple H. The Rock at the time went ahead to compare Undertaker to a demon in an Exorcist movie, including a few more insults, which led to the WWE Hall of Famer accepting the challenge. (via Sportster)

The Rock defeated The Undertaker and Triple H in a triple threat after they attacked each other. The win against Undertaker and Triple H earned The Rock the WWF title match at that year’s King of the Rings PPV. Fans have noted that the chemistry between Rock and Undertaker never really sits well, which is why they have never really faced each other in the ring for a long time.

Despite an amazing event held on night two of WrestleMania 40, fans have one complaint: instead of The Undertaker, it should have been Stone Cold Steve Austin who should have shown up against The Rock and assisted Cody Rhodes. Fans enjoyed the fact that the Dead Man showed up and choke-slammed the Great One, but Stone Cold and The Rock’s rivalry has been one of the highlights of WWWEl for decades, which is why they expected to see him in the ring.

The Sportster reported that one of the reasons for their feud has been a bit personal, as Stone Cold’s wife at the time, Debra, was standing by The Rock’s side as his manager, as assigned by Vince McMahon. The rivalry and the feud between the two of them defined a generation and an era of wrestling. The feud between the two widely celebrated and admired professional wrestlers has been one of the most memorable parts of the Attitude Era.
